A well known member of the "WLS BARN DANCE" He was the original "Ramblin Jack".He sang with the greats, Gene Autry,Rex Allen,Tex Ritter,Bob Atcher,and many,many more. With the outbreak of World War II he enlisted in the US Army,and went on to become highly decorated including the Bronze Star with Valor Attachment.

He did not return to entertainment after the war. He married and went on to found two local Boy Scout Chapters, and was charter President of the local chapter of Lions Club of America. He was also a life-time member of the Loyal Order of the Moose.
